diff --git a/src/client/configurationmanager.cpp b/src/client/configurationmanager.cpp
index a5dfa0305a521d622bbb9eb956232197abd85f02..b2b628535864af7c0ddabe91c1e3b85f3606f2f3 100644
--- a/src/client/configurationmanager.cpp
+++ b/src/client/configurationmanager.cpp
@@ -1032,7 +1032,7 @@ lookupAddress(const std::string& account, const std::string& nameserver, const s
                            [address](const std::string& regName, const std::string& addr,
                                      jami::NameDirectory::Response response) {
                                jami::emitSignal<libjami::ConfigurationSignal::RegisteredNameFound>(
-                                   "", address, (int) response, regName, addr);
+                                   "", address, (int) response, addr, regName);
                            });
         return true;
     } else if (auto acc = jami::Manager::instance().getAccount<JamiAccount>(account)) {